サイトがhttpsとhttpの両方のプロトコルを有効にしている場合、SEOと統一性を考慮して、httpアクセスをhttpsにリダイレクトします。LNMPワンクリックパッケージまたはnginxを使用している場合は、以下の方法で301リダイレクトをhttpsに実現できます。

サイトの設定ファイルを開きます。例えば、Naibaノートの設定ファイルは/usr/local/nginx/conf/vhost/blog.naibabiji.com.confです。開くと大体以下のような形式です。
server {
listen 80;
server_name blog.naibabiji.com;
省略其他配置
}
server {
listen 443 ssl;
server_name blog.naibabiji.com;
省略其他配置
}修正が必要なのは、listen 80; の一連のコードの内容です(80はhttp、443はhttps)。
server {
listen 80;
server_name blog.naibabiji.com;
return 301 https://blog.naibabiji.com$request_uri;
}
server {
listen 443 ssl;
server_name blog.naibabiji.com;
省略其他配置
}その後、保存してnginxを再起動すると、httpアクセスがhttpsにリダイレクトされます。
コメントは終了しました
この記事のコメント機能は終了しています。ご質問がある場合は、他の方法でお問い合わせください。